From protective shell to engineered safety system
Historically, helmets were largely “hard shell plus padding.” Today, the industry standard approach is a layered system that manages impact forces and improves comfort for sustained wear. The key difference is that modern helmets are built as engineered systems: an outer shell, an energy-absorbing liner (often EPS foam), and an internal fit system that stabilizes the helmet on the head during motion.
In the late 20th and early 21st centuries, widespread adoption of performance standards and improved materials accelerated this shift. For example, bicycle helmets commonly reference impact and retention test requirements under certifications such as CPSC (U.S.), EN 1078 (Europe), and ASTM testing protocols used by manufacturers and testing labs. When riders seek “urban style,” they are effectively choosing helmets that also meet widely accepted safety benchmarks.
Design advances that support city comfort
Urban commuting creates unique demands: frequent stops, variable weather, and long carry times. Helmet manufacturers responded by emphasizing features that riders can feel every day, including ventilation channels, sweat management, lighter weights, and stable fit.
- Ventilation: Many modern helmets include multiple intake and exhaust vents to reduce heat buildup during rides in summer months.
- Weight reduction: Lighter helmets can improve long-duration comfort, especially for daily commuters.
- Fit adjustment: Dial-based or strap-based retention systems help the helmet sit securely without excessive tightness.
- Modular styling: Sleek lines and minimalist shapes often pair with streetwear aesthetics.

Conversational QA: “Do stylish helmets still meet safety standards?”
Yes—when they are certified. Helmet style should never replace safety testing. To verify performance, look for compliance with recognized standards such as CPSC for the U.S. or EN 1078 in Europe, and check whether the helmet is intended for the activity you’re doing (for example, cycling versus skate-style use where applicable).

How designers balance visuals with engineering
There is an important practical constraint: external graphics and finishes must be applied in ways that do not compromise structural integrity. Helmet manufacturers typically use durable coatings and robust printing techniques designed for abrasion and weather exposure.
Conversational QA: “Will stickers or DIY graphics reduce helmet safety?” In general, modification is risky. The safe approach is to use only manufacturer-approved accessories or replacement parts. Altering the shell surface or internal components can impact fit, coverage, or performance. If you want a custom look, choose a helmet that ships with approved design options.

Choosing a Helmet That Matches Your Urban Style (Without Compromising Safety)
The best urban helmet is one that looks like your style and fits like it belongs to you. The direct answer is to buy based on certification, correct size, and a secure retention system, then finalize your choice with color and design.
Step-by-step: how to pick the right urban helmet
Use this checklist to combine style preferences with safety-critical selection:
- Verify certification: Look for recognized compliance such as CPSC or EN 1078.
- Fit is non-negotiable: The helmet should sit level and low on the forehead without wobble.
- Retention system: Straps should form a stable “Y” under/near the ear and tighten comfortably.
- Coverage: Ensure the helmet covers the crown and front areas appropriately for the activity.
- Comfort for the commute: Ventilation and padding matter for real daily wear.
- Pick your aesthetic last: Choose your colorway and graphic style once the fit and certification are confirmed.
When to replace a helmet
Even the most stylish helmet should be retired after significant impacts or when the materials degrade. A widely accepted guideline is to replace a helmet after a crash that causes any impact to the head/helmet, and to follow the manufacturer’s replacement interval recommendations.

Are matte and glossy helmet finishes a style choice—or do they change performance?
- Matte finishes: often hide minor scratches and fingerprints better, making them popular for daily commuter wear. They can also create a modern “low-gloss” look that pairs well with streetwear.
- Glossy finishes: can look more vivid and “premium,” catching light more strongly. However, they may show scuffs or smudges more easily depending on the coating.
- Heat and glare: in intense sunlight, a darker glossy surface may appear hotter visually and can sometimes create more glare. Matte finishes tend to look less reflective.
